    To be blunt combat was never Sota's strong point, but seriously something needs to be done...

    1. Melee combat is like playing with Magnets, first you struggle to push them together then you can't keep them from snapping together. Trying maintain position with your back away from the Mobs is now a mini-game all by itself, that isn't fun it's frustrating. Your constantly charging past the mobs, turning to face odd angles. basically you must dedicate a hand to constantly moving rotating your character just to face your enemy. If the game is going to take care of positioning, then take care of it and let me watch youtube or something until it's over. Otherwise.. what the freak are you doing moving my character for me... I put my avatar in the position I wanted him, and he has no reason to move anywhere on his own. If I want him to move, I'll move him. Currently I feel as though a menatally challenged person is wrestling me for control of my character while in melee combat.
    2. Mobs running in fear before you get to them. Um.. sure if they are like green I get that, but 6 yellow wolves I run up on them and they all scatter to the winds at a faster travel speed than I can manage. Now I have another mini-game, where I attempt to force a mob to flee against a server wall so I can attempt to kill it.
    3. Pulling, so I got myself some Obsidian Arrow Training just to counter full health mobs fleeing in fear before I can attack them. Was working Great, I shoot then they run to me and try to extract revenge. Now I shoot they take 0 damage, my cool down is shot, and and I am back to chasing the mobs to a server wall to catch them.
    4. Root, Root works more often than obsidian arrow, but it's on a 30 second cooldown.. yellow mobs die in less than 10 seconds so it's only good for every other kill. (would be every third kill but it takes so long to chase down the non-root kill that it's only every other kill.
    5. Tamed creature travel speed. They are incredibly slow walkers, they can't keep up. If you run (not sprinting just normal running) around chasing mobs, when you finally do catch the mob your pet will be so far away that it won't arrive until after the mob is dead, or it will only get one attack. So you have to toggle off combat mode, chase mobs out of combat then Time hitting the teleport pet hot key before you break out your sword.
    6. Stacking Glyphs.. unless they crit it isn't worth the time or effort I can do more damage faster and earn more xp from killing by not stacking instead of stacking. Sure for a special opponent I can see stacking for the opening move hoping for a crit, but after that, it's a waste of combat attention to wait for stacks, instead of using the abilities that come up. Personally I could care less if this issue got addressed, Stacking is a useless mechanic, but it doesn't affect me to not use it...
    7. Powered Attacks.. How many mice and how many hands do developers have? cause I only have two hands and 1 mouse.. How are we supposed to stack glyphs, Use glyphs, Maintain position? and power Power Attacks? at the same time? I must be playing the game wrong.. Cause I dont' see how anyone can do all that for an 8 hour sitting.. I'm probably in the majority when I say Auto-Attack + asingle stack glyphs is all I honestly use, the rest is kinda like emotes.. Sure sitting around being bored I can do a powered attack and check out what they do, but for the Day to Day grinding.. another useless game feature. Again I don't care if this doesn't get fixed cause I don't use it.

    it's completely disable-able. get out of reticle mode by hitting tab, go into your keymappings, go down to the one that is assigned to tab (toggle cursor), click in the box and hit backspace. no more mapping, can't switch accidentally.
